THE ROLE : The Senior Manager of Financial Reporting oversees the company’s consolidated financial reporting function, ensuring the accurate, timely, and compliant preparation of internal and external financial statements and reports. This position plays a key leadership role in maintaining the integrity of financial data, internal controls, and reporting processes across multiple homebuilding divisions. The Senior Manager partners closely with executive management, finance, operations, and audit teams to deliver financial insight that informs strategic decision-making and supports the company’s growth, profitability, and compliance objectives.
